I will change the status like:
http://www..../status/changestatus.php?on
http://www..../status/changestatus.php?off
is there a security-issue because i have to set the status file writeable
how can i prevent someone else changing it
By password-protecting the status directory, if if not also used to
query the status. You usually do this in the webserver.
